🔥 What Is Tease and Denial?
At its core, tease and denial is the act of stimulating your partner to the brink of orgasm — only to stop before release. This practice intensifies physical sensitivity and amplifies mental arousal, creating a loop of craving and anticipation.

💬 Communication Is Everything
Like all BDSM play, tease and denial thrives on consent and communication. Use a safe word, check in often, and talk about limits beforehand. If done right, this kind of play can deepen trust, intimacy, and mutual arousal.
For beginners, start small — maybe just five minutes of edging. As you learn each other’s limits and rhythms, increase the intensity and length of denial.
